→Material composition (e.g., latex-free, hypoallergenic)
+
Why this matters: Material composition affects consumer health concerns and influences AI ranking based on safety signals.
→Size options (small, medium, large)
+
Why this matters: Size options help match user queries for specific needs, improving relevance in AI matches.
→Adhesive type (permanent, repositionable)
+
Why this matters: Adhesive type is critical for allergy-sensitive customers, impacting AI decision-making on suitable products.
→Water resistance level
+
Why this matters: Water resistance level determines product suitability for active or outdoor use, boosting relevance.
→Breathability (air permeability ratings)
+
Why this matters: Breathability ratings are often queried by consumers with skin sensitivities, affecting AI recommendations.
→Shelf life/expiration date
+
Why this matters: Shelf life and expiration date signals ensure freshness, important filters in AI-driven product selection.

❓ Frequently Asked Questions
How do AI assistants recommend products?+
AI assistants analyze product reviews, ratings, schema markup, and detailed product attributes to generate recommendations tailored to consumer queries.
How many reviews does a product need to rank well?+
Research indicates that products with at least 50 verified reviews and an average rating of 4 stars or higher tend to be favored in AI recommendations.
What's the minimum rating for AI recommendation?+
AI engines typically prioritize products with ratings of 4.0 or above, meaning maintaining high ratings is crucial for recommendation potential.
Does product price affect AI recommendations?+
Yes, competitive pricing data and value propositions influence AI algorithms, making price optimization an essential component of visibility strategies.
Do product reviews need to be verified?+
Verified reviews significantly enhance AI trust signals, as they confirm genuine consumer experiences, improving product ranking likelihood.
